Based on dividend-adjusted daily data since Jul 26, 2010, SCHYY's average daily return is +0.06%, while the average monthly return is +1.12%. At this rate, an investment would double in approximately 5.2 years.

Historically, 50% of months were positive and 50% were negative. The best month was Nov 2022 with a return of +55.7%, while the worst month was Sep 2021 at -36.1%. The longest winning streak lasted 7 consecutive months, and the longest losing streak was 8 months.

On a daily basis, SCHYY closed higher 48% of trading days. The best single day was Jan 14, 2022 with a return of +25.1%, while the worst single day was Sep 15, 2021 at -25.1%.

Sands China Ltd ADR has an annualized alpha of 3.58%, beta of 0.83, and R2 of 0.10 versus S&P 500 Index. Calculated based on daily prices since July 26, 2010.

  • This stock participated in 131.89% of S&P 500 Index downside but only 95.28% of its upside - more exposed to losses than it benefited from rallies.
  • R2 of 0.10 means this stock moves largely independently of S&P 500 Index - capture ratios reflect limited market correlation rather than active downside protection. Consider using a more representative benchmark.
